Interfaith Baccalaureate Service
Saturday, May 9, 2015 at 2:00 PM, Callahan Theater
The Class of 2015 will gather with their families and friends for this year’s Interfaith Baccalaureate Service.
This year’s class has chosen the theme “Bearing the Light” and has selected readings and prayers from a variety of faith traditions. The Nazareth Chamber Singers will also sing a beautiful Celtic Blessing that was composed specifically for Baccalaureate. The Interfaith Baccalaureate Service includes reflections on the theme by this year's speaker Sr. Barbabra Lum, SSJ, a Naz alumna who was instrumental in the historic events which were depicted in the movie "Selma".
